"The Upside of Stress" by Kelly McGonigal does provide evidence that supports the value of self-efficacy in a quantifiable manner. McGonigal's book explores how changing one's mindset about stress can transform stress from a negative experience into a positive one. A significant part of this transformation involves self-efficacy-the belief in one's ability to manage and overcome stress.
